Knowing how to insert a footer in Excel is an important skill for anyone who works with spreadsheets, reports, or printed documents. A footer appears at the bottom of each printed page and is commonly used to display information such as page numbers, file names, dates, sheet names, or company details. Adding a footer helps make Excel documents look more professional, organized, and easier to reference.

  1. What a Footer Is in Excel

A footer is a section that appears at the bottom of a printed Excel page.
